commit:     648ae1721f2c00dc0c430df1780e11bca6c01ef2
Author:     Anthony G. Basile <blueness <AT> gentoo <DOT> org>
AuthorDate: Sun Jun 26 00:05:34 2016 +0000
Commit:     Anthony G. Basile <blueness <AT> gentoo <DOT> org>
CommitDate: Sun Jun 26 00:05:34 2016 +0000
URL:        https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=648ae172

dev-libs/opensc: add libressl support

Package-Manager: portage-2.2.28

 dev-libs/opensc/opensc-0.14.0.ebuild | 9 ++++++---
 dev-libs/opensc/opensc-0.15.0.ebuild | 9 ++++++---
 dev-libs/opensc/opensc-0.16.0.ebuild | 7 +++++--
 3 files changed, 17 insertions(+), 8 deletions(-)

diff --git a/dev-libs/opensc/opensc-0.14.0.ebuild 
b/dev-libs/opensc/opensc-0.14.0.ebuild
index 3fc15f8..2003be3 100644
--- a/dev-libs/opensc/opensc-0.14.0.ebuild
+++ b/dev-libs/opensc/opensc-0.14.0.ebuild
@@ -1,4 +1,4 @@
-# Copyright 1999-2015 Gentoo Foundation
+# Copyright 1999-2016 Gentoo Foundation
 # Distributed under the terms of the GNU General Public License v2
 # $Id$
 
@@ -13,11 +13,14 @@ SRC_URI="mirror://sourceforge/${PN}/${P}.tar.gz"
 LICENSE="LGPL-2.1"
 SLOT="0"
 KEYWORDS="~alpha ~amd64 ~arm ~hppa ~ia64 ~m68k ~ppc ~ppc64 ~s390 ~sh ~sparc 
~x86"
-IUSE="doc +pcsc-lite secure-messaging openct ctapi readline ssl zlib"
+IUSE="doc +pcsc-lite secure-messaging openct ctapi readline libressl ssl zlib"
 
 RDEPEND="zlib? ( sys-libs/zlib )
        readline? ( sys-libs/readline:0= )
-       ssl? ( dev-libs/openssl:0= )
+       ssl? (
+               !libressl? ( dev-libs/openssl:0= )
+               libressl? ( dev-libs/libressl:0= )
+       )
        openct? ( >=dev-libs/openct-0.5.0 )
        pcsc-lite? ( >=sys-apps/pcsc-lite-1.3.0 )"
 DEPEND="${RDEPEND}

diff --git a/dev-libs/opensc/opensc-0.15.0.ebuild 
b/dev-libs/opensc/opensc-0.15.0.ebuild
index 3fc15f8..2003be3 100644
--- a/dev-libs/opensc/opensc-0.15.0.ebuild
+++ b/dev-libs/opensc/opensc-0.15.0.ebuild
@@ -1,4 +1,4 @@
-# Copyright 1999-2015 Gentoo Foundation
+# Copyright 1999-2016 Gentoo Foundation
 # Distributed under the terms of the GNU General Public License v2
 # $Id$
 
@@ -13,11 +13,14 @@ SRC_URI="mirror://sourceforge/${PN}/${P}.tar.gz"
 LICENSE="LGPL-2.1"
 SLOT="0"
 KEYWORDS="~alpha ~amd64 ~arm ~hppa ~ia64 ~m68k ~ppc ~ppc64 ~s390 ~sh ~sparc 
~x86"
-IUSE="doc +pcsc-lite secure-messaging openct ctapi readline ssl zlib"
+IUSE="doc +pcsc-lite secure-messaging openct ctapi readline libressl ssl zlib"
 
 RDEPEND="zlib? ( sys-libs/zlib )
        readline? ( sys-libs/readline:0= )
-       ssl? ( dev-libs/openssl:0= )
+       ssl? (
+               !libressl? ( dev-libs/openssl:0= )
+               libressl? ( dev-libs/libressl:0= )
+       )
        openct? ( >=dev-libs/openct-0.5.0 )
        pcsc-lite? ( >=sys-apps/pcsc-lite-1.3.0 )"
 DEPEND="${RDEPEND}

diff --git a/dev-libs/opensc/opensc-0.16.0.ebuild 
b/dev-libs/opensc/opensc-0.16.0.ebuild
index 4d50416..55030e4 100644
--- a/dev-libs/opensc/opensc-0.16.0.ebuild
+++ b/dev-libs/opensc/opensc-0.16.0.ebuild
@@ -13,11 +13,14 @@ 
SRC_URI="https://github.com/OpenSC/OpenSC/releases/download/${PV}/${P}.tar.gz";
 LICENSE="LGPL-2.1"
 SLOT="0"
 KEYWORDS="~alpha ~amd64 ~arm ~hppa ~ia64 ~m68k ~ppc ~ppc64 ~s390 ~sh ~sparc 
~x86"
-IUSE="doc +pcsc-lite secure-messaging openct ctapi readline ssl zlib"
+IUSE="doc +pcsc-lite secure-messaging openct ctapi readline libressl ssl zlib"
 
 RDEPEND="zlib? ( sys-libs/zlib )
        readline? ( sys-libs/readline:0= )
-       ssl? ( dev-libs/openssl:0= )
+       ssl? (
+               !libressl? ( dev-libs/openssl:0= )
+               libressl? ( dev-libs/libressl:0= )
+       )
        openct? ( >=dev-libs/openct-0.5.0 )
        pcsc-lite? ( >=sys-apps/pcsc-lite-1.3.0 )"
 DEPEND="${RDEPEND}

Reply via email to